管理Oracle数据库的最佳实践包括以下几个方面:
定期备份数据库:定期备份是保护数据库数据的重要手段,可以避免数据丢失或损坏。建议使用Oracle提供的备份工具进行全量备份和增量备份,并将备份数据存储在安全的位置。
监控数据库性能:定期监控数据库性能,包括CPU利用率、内存利用率、磁盘空间利用率等指标,及时发现和解决性能问题,提高数据库的稳定性和性能。
优化数据库结构:定期进行数据库结构优化,如索引优化、表空间管理、分区表管理等,提高数据库的查询效率和性能。
定期进行数据库维护:定期进行数据库维护,如清理日志文件、优化数据库配置、执行统计信息收集等,保持数据库的健康状态。
实施访问控制:建立合适的访问控制策略,限制用户对数据库的访问权限,减少潜在的安全风险。
定期更新数据库软件:定期更新数据库软件,安装最新的补丁和安全更新,以保持数据库系统的安全性和稳定性。
实施灾备方案:建立灾备方案,确保在数据库发生故障或灾难时能够及时恢复数据,并尽量减少业务中断时间。
建立监控报警系统:建立数据库监控报警系统,及时发现数据库异常和故障,采取相应的措施进行处理,保证数据库的持续运行。
总的来说,管理Oracle数据库的最佳实践是定期备份、监控性能、优化结构、进行维护、实施访问控制、更新软件、建立灾备方案和建立监控报警系统。通过这些方法可以保证数据库的安全、稳定和高效运行。